Architectural Plagiarism

Hell hath no fury like an architect scorned. The NY Post reports that Kathryn Fee designed a "gracious, shingled estate" on Noyack Path in Water Mill, but that the homeowner, Diana Cochran, didn't pay the bill and so she left. But then Cochran turned around and gave a copy of the plans to a new architect, Bruce Siska, who "passed off the almost mirror-image designs as his own." Obviously, everyone's suing everyone now.
